The job utilizes a combination of skills including:

Clerical computer and phone skills

Customer service/people skills

Medical terminology

Hands on clinical skills

Typical job skills include:

Taking vital signs like pulse and blood pressure

Updating medications, allergies and other information in patient’s medical records

Performing some medical procedures, specimen collection and lab testing

The position will support the delivery of cost-effective, clinically competent, reliable healthcare by following the core values of Providence Medical Group – Justice, Excellence, Dignity, Integrity, and Compassion. Medical Assistants work under the delegation of a licensed practitioner to perform duties as directed and assist in providing basic patient care to assigned patients. This role is responsible for administrative and clinical tasks, such as maintaining patient records, preparing patients and rooms for examination, and assisting physicians with exams. Medical Assistants are expected to perform in accordance with established policies, procedures, and regulations.

Associate Medical Assistant (MAI)

Required qualifications:

Coursework/Training - Graduate of an accredited school that includes hands on training in a clinical setting for medical assistants or,

Coursework/Training - Graduate of a registered medical assistant apprenticeship program or,

Coursework/Training - Has completed two years of medical training in the United States Armed Forces or,

Coursework/Training - Minimum one year of work experience as a medical assistant that includes the following clinical skills: obtaining vital signs, administering injections, and medication administration.

Upon Hire: National Provider BLS - American Heart Association

Medical assisting experience in a clinic setting (0-6 months).

Preferred qualifications:

6 months of prior experience providing a high level of customer service in a fast-paced environment

6 months of previous experience in a healthcare setting working with an Electronic Health record (EHR)

Associate Medical Assistant Salary Range, Oregon: Min: $ 20.38, Max: $30.54
